What should I do if my Teddy dog ​​smells bad? Bathing the Teddy dog ​​regularly and using professional pet shower gel can eliminate skin odor; cleaning the Teddy dog’s ears regularly can remove the odor to a certain extent; Teddy dog The anal glands are also the source of body odor and should be cleaned regularly to avoid odor.

1. Take a bath regularly

The sebaceous glands and sweat glands of Teddy dogs secrete a substance with a strong smell, and the smell of Teddy dogs will be worse in summer than in winter. However, this secretion and odor can be removed by bathing, so the owner must bathe the Teddy dog ​​regularly. Although it should not be too frequent, bathing once or twice a week in summer is still necessary. When bathing a Teddy dog, you need to use a dog-specific bath shampoo, because this kind of bath shampoo is developed according to the dog's physical condition and can effectively remove the odor from the Teddy dog.

 2. Clean ears

Secondly, you should clean the Teddy dog’s ears regularly in life. Dog earwax also forms very quickly, and is mainly white, light yellow, or yellow in color, and its shape ranges from powdery, lumpy, to mushy. Generally speaking, this is normal. However, the owner must use ear drops and ear oil to remove the earwax in time. If it is not cleaned for a long time, it will easily breed ear mites. In severe cases, it will induce ear diseases and cause the Teddy dog ​​to have a strong body odor.

3. Clean anal glands

The anal glands of Teddy dogs will secrete anal gland fluid. The smell of this anal gland fluid is very smelly. If it is not cleaned regularly, the anal gland fluid will accumulate and produce a very strong odor. It can even cause inflammation of the anal glands, so every time you bathe your Teddy dog, the owner must pay attention to cleaning their anal glands.
